I made this lap quilt for a friend of mine from China. She's a student at our local college. She was going home for the summer and I wanted to give her something. I was going to do the "Warm Wishes" pattern but decided to just use the striped material. I got this "bright idea" about 2 weeks before she was to go home. haha Anyway, I got it done and did SID on my machine. To brighten up the edge, I sewed strips of the rainbow fabric together.
I used the fabric with the cats because Victoria loves my mom' s cats...Boo and Tiger. She loves the colors of the rainbow and she likes to work jigsaw puzzles when she stays with my mom and dad. I found the red print fabric with the English alphabet and thought it would be neat to use it because she is learning our language. She will be coming back in a few weeks to attend college again.
